Persistent Protein: An Early Sign of CKD

2013-10-23 14:27| Font Size A A A

As we all know, urine is a typical symptom of kidney disease. Generally, there is a quantitative protein exists in human body, neither too much nor too little, which is indispensable to human life. If only urine micro protein, it basically means normal renal function. But if it is found that urine protein is persistent, you need to carefully control it. It might be an early sign of Chronic Kidney Disease (CKD).

If kidney function is normal, only a tiny amount of protein appears in the urine. But when there is something wrong with kidney and ureter, more quantity of proteins would be leaked out and form proteinuria. When the protein content in urine up to more than 0.15 g / 24 h, proteinuria would be formed.

If appeared urine protein only once, it might be transient. It needed to review routine urine for many times, if necessary, 24 hours urine protein quantitative test can be used to identify whether the kidney function id damaged. Generally, glomerular filtration barrier damage will have protein leakage.
